What is it?• A computational cognitive agent that can:
– Understand and communicate in English; – Discuss specific, generic, and “rule-like” information;– Reason;– Discuss acts and plans;– Sense;– Act;– Maintain a model of itself;– Remember and report what it has sensed and done.

SNePS• A logic-based KR system
• using reified propositions
• with special constructs for acts
• and an acting executive
• as well as an inference engine
• with an ATMS.
• From a Wumpus World agent:– all(r)(Isa(r,room)
=> whendo(In(r), believe(~Contains(r,pit)))).

Kinds of Self-Awarenessin Cassie
• Static beliefs (non-fluents) about herself Knows and recognizes her name.
– My name is `Cassie’.
• Has first-person, privileged knowledge of ,
remembers, and can tell what she’s done.
Has a sense of time, including “now”.
Knows whom she is conversing with.– I talked to Bill and I am talking to you.
• Has self-perception of what she says.

Basic Approach toEssential Self-Awareness
• Beliefs about self at KL (mind)
inserted by PML (body).

How It’s Implementedat the KL
• SNePS term denoting Cassie– Used in all beliefs about herself.
• SNePS terms denoting times– To relate acts/events
• Representation of acts is the same– For acts to be done by Cassie
– For acts done by Cassie
– For acts done by other agents
– For acting
– For NL interaction

How It’s Implementedat the PML
• Deictic Registers– I = SNePS term denoting Cassie
– NOW = SNePS term denoting current time
– YOU = SNePS term denoting conversational partner

How It’s Implementedat the PML
• Lisp implementation of KL primitive acts
• Implementation of act a inserts KL belief that
I did a NOW
and moves NOW.
= First person, privileged belief.

Body-Mind FeedbackMost Difficult Issue
• When should mind move to next step of plan?
• When sense that goal of previous step has been achieved.
• For speech sequence:
when hear self over self-perception socket.

Next Steps
• Since awareness of acting is
added by implementation of primitive acts,
don’t yet have awareness of non-primitive acts.
• Put all this in architecture,
so agent implementers needn’t be concerned.
